My builder has refused to hand over my plot despite having a complete sale deed. Now they’re saying the project is cancelled because the town planning department changed the layout. But instead of offering me a plot according to this new layout, they’re still refusing to give me possession! My lawyer says I might be out of luck because the builder might have sold all the plots. Is there any legal way to get my plot? The worst part is, I never received any notice about these changes, I only found out when I contacted the town planning office myself.

You have a valid sale deed and the builder is obligated to hand over the plot as per the agreement. The change in layout does not excuse the builder from fulfilling the contract. Consult a lawyer immediately to file a legal suit against the builder for breach of contract and non-delivery of possession. You have the right to seek compensation for damages incurred due to the delay.
